4. Technical Scaffolding Knowledge
Strong technical knowledge is an important requirement for the position.
Candidates should be familiar with Tube and Fittings and Cuplock scaffolding systems. Knowledge of Saudi Aramco standards, work permits, confined-space requirements, and safe working procedures is also highlighted in the advertisement.
A Scaffolding Supervisor is responsible for ensuring that scaffolding activities are carried out correctly and safely. Technical knowledge can therefore play an important role during both the interview and the actual job.

Leadership Skills Required for Scaffolding Supervisors
The vacancy also emphasizes leadership and team-management skills.
A Scaffolding Supervisor may be responsible for managing crews and ensuring that work is completed safely and according to project requirements. Candidates should be capable of managing approximately two or more crews, depending on project requirements.
Good leadership involves assigning work, monitoring progress, correcting unsafe practices, maintaining discipline, coordinating with other teams, and ensuring that workers follow established safety procedures.
